#74a382 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#74a382 is composed of 45.5% red, 63.9% green and 51%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 28.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 20.2% yellow and 36.1% black. It has a hue angle of 137.9 degrees, a saturation of 20.3% and a lightness of 54.7%. #74a382 color hex could be obtained by blending #e8ffff with #004705. Closest websafe color is: #669999.

#74a382 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#74a382 has RGB values of R:116, G:163, B:130 and CMYK values of C:0.29, M:0, Y:0.2, K:0.36. Its decimal value is 7644034.

Shades and Tints of #74a382

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020302 is the darkest color, while #f6f9f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#74a382

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#869189 is the less saturated color, while #1bfc5e is the most saturated one.
